Kenny, take a look at a Calabria platform if you can. Calabria cuts an oval (in profile) groove that is about 1/4" deep, the entire width of the platfrom in the rearmost plank. The groove is about 3/4" forward of the trailing edge of the platform. It seems to work well enough for climbing in or hanging on while swimming around behind the boat. <BR> <BR>It wouldn't take much woodworking skill to clamp down a straight edge and run a router across the platform.
